首页>  如何在Chrome浏览器中减少多余的HTTP请求

如何在Chrome浏览器中减少多余的HTTP请求

来源:Chrome浏览器官网 时间:2025/05/12

如何在Chrome浏览器中减少多余的HTTP请求1

在Chrome浏览器中,减少多余的HTTP请求可以显著提升网页加载速度和用户体验。以下是一些有效的方法:
一、优化图片资源
1. 清理不必要的图片:定期检查网页中的图片库,删除那些不再使用或与当前内容无关的图片。例如,如果某个网页的布局已经更新,之前用于该页面但现在不再显示的图片就可以删除。
2. 合并图片:对于一些小图标或背景图片等,可以考虑将它们合并成一张大图,即雪碧图。这样只需要一次HTTP请求就可以获取多张图片,减少了请求数量。比如网站的导航栏图标、按钮背景图等可以合并。
3. 使用合适的图片格式和大小:根据图片的内容和用途选择合适的格式,如JPEG适合照片存储,PNG适合透明图像或简单图形。同时,调整图片的大小,避免过大的图片占用过多的网络带宽和加载时间。可以使用图像编辑工具对图片进行压缩,以减小文件大小。
二、整合脚本和样式表
1. 合并脚本文件:将多个JavaScript脚本文件合并为一个文件。如果网页中使用了多个外部JS文件,每个文件都会产生一个HTTP请求,合并后可以减少请求次数。不过在合并时要注意代码的兼容性和可读性。
2. 内联关键样式:对于一些关键的CSS样式,可以将其直接写在HTML标签的style属性中,这样可以避免单独的CSS文件请求。但这种方法只适用于少量的关键样式,对于大量的样式还是应该放在外部CSS文件中进行管理。
3. 精简样式表:去除CSS文件中未使用的样式规则和重复的样式定义,减小CSS文件的大小。可以使用一些在线工具或专业的CSS压缩软件来进行精简。
三、利用缓存
1. 设置缓存头:通过服务器配置,为静态资源(如图片、脚本、样式表等)设置合适的缓存头信息。例如,可以设置较长的过期时间,让浏览器在一段时间内重复使用缓存的资源,而不是每次都发起HTTP请求。
2. 使用CDN:内容分发网络(CDN)可以将网站的静态资源分发到全球多个服务器节点上。当用户访问网页时,CDN会根据用户的地理位置选择最近的服务器来提供资源,这样可以加快资源的获取速度,并且CDN服务器通常会对资源进行缓存,进一步减少HTTP请求。
总的来说,在Chrome浏览器中减少多余的HTTP请求需要从优化图片资源、整合脚本和样式表以及利用缓存等多个方面入手。通过合理运用这些方法,可以有效提升网页的加载性能,为用户提供更快速、流畅的浏览体验。

上一篇: 如何通过Chrome浏览器启用和禁用扩展程序 下一篇: 如何通过Chrome浏览器减少页面加载时的资源等待

TOP